Output e9bfa7aea401185be64263e24c28035f664832a32aa896e271e8bd92c9ac9a74:3

value
1787774166
script pubkey
OP_0 OP_PUSHBYTES_20 d5019156adb3e8669b151b6dca09725d1c1669b4
address
tb1q65qez44dk05xdxc4rdku5ztjt5wpv6d5j7fzv2
transaction
e9bfa7aea401185be64263e24c28035f664832a32aa896e271e8bd92c9ac9a74
confirmations
130582
spent
true